Citation Sovereign (C680) XP10 Chg 10 10.04rc3

Converted to 10.04rc3, this C680 variant presents a 2-D panel with default instruments and two main color variants, White and Black, plus additional options. Engines require 45–60 seconds to stabilize after start for taxi and takeoff, while Flight Idle and Ground Idle maintain bleed air for pressurization, and an AOA gauge supports precise approaches.

XPFW B727 AI Pack 1.0

Twelve Boeing 727s appear with markings from Air Canada, Alitalia, American, Continental, Delta, Eastern, Lufthansa, Pan Am, Tame, Western, DHL, and FedEx. The author removes panels, sounds, and instruments, trims excess 3D, and simplifies the flightmodel to reduce calculations, delivering a notable performance increase and enabling operation with at least ten aircraft.
